About Jay Chou suing a restaurant in Xiamen, an online celebrity, how did the restaurant respond?
In Xiamen, there is an online celebrity restaurant with the theme of Jay Chou. The restaurant is covered with posters of Jay Chou, and the dishes are named after Jay Chou's songs. As a result, many fans thought this was a restaurant opened by Jay Chou, so they punched in for dinner. But this year, in order to protect his portrait right, Jay Chou took the restaurant to court, saying that it was not legally authorized.

Jay Chou, the plaintiff, claimed that the restaurant had the following illegal acts without its own legal authorization: 1. Use the plaintiff's portrait on the electronic screen and wall-mounted TV in the restaurant.

Second, the menu cover and title page of the restaurant use the portrait of the plaintiff.

Thirdly, the portrait of the plaintiff is widely used in the decoration design of the restaurant, and the portrait of the plaintiff is used in the luminous wave portrait wall.

Fourth, on public platforms such as public comments and word of mouth, the restaurant was opened by the plaintiff, misleading consumers.

5. Use the plaintiff's personal logo at the entrance of the restaurant.

Jay Chou sued the restaurant and demanded compensation according to law.

But August 19, what's the name of this house? Hero j? The restaurant responded through its official Weibo. The official Weibo told the story of the establishment of the restaurant, and also showed that the restaurant was authorized by joining.

When J Xia Xiamen Store opened, Jay Chou and his partner vincent fang once expressed their congratulations. The above picture shows the relevant authorization responsibility letter displayed by the official Weibo.

The restaurant said that as a franchise store, after learning that the authorization was suddenly suspended, they immediately contacted Beijing Magic Tianlun and made a series of rectification in coordination with Jay Chou's request, which was affirmed. However, in February 20 19, 19, they learned that the restaurant was sued, and the material evidence of the prosecution was the video and picture materials before they cooperated with the rectification.

Official Weibo posted relevant contracts and email screenshots to prove his innocence, and stressed that he never cheated consumers.

Now, Xiamen Haicang Court has officially heard the case and is still following up.
